- The distance between Greenwood, Sc, Usa and Ertholmene, Christiansø, Denmark is approximately 7,372 km or 4,581 mi.
- To reach Greenwood, Sc in this distance one would set out from Ertholmene, Christiansø bearing 296.4°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Greenwood, Sc bearing 218.1° or SW .
- Greenwood, Sc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Ertholmene, Christiansø has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- The average annual temperature is 7.2 °C (13°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.8 °C (5°F) more in Greenwood, Sc.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 745.2 mm (29.3 in) more which is equivalent to 745.2 l/m² (18.29 US gal/ft²) or 7,452,000 l/ha (796,668 US gal/ac) more. About 2 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.1° higher in Greenwood, Sc than in Ertholmene, Christiansø.
